    What 2nd rounders from this draft do you think have the potential to play meaningful minutes as rookies?

    Im gonna go with a few guys:

    1) Ray McCallum – If Tyreke and Marcus Thornton are on the way out, there could be a decent amount of minutes available to Mccallum. He has NBA quickness and skills and I think he can give SAC some decent minutes if they decide to move some players, which I think they will.

    2) Nate Wolters – BOLD prediction here, but I believe he will be starting over (or maybe with) MCW by christmas. He is more NBA ready than MCW and theres plenty of minutes available in the Philly backcourt now with Jrue gone.

    3) Erik Murphy – I will admit there is just as good a chance that he doesn’t even make the team. That said, he is a phenomenal shooter and CHI is going to need a stretch 4 to open up lanes for a healthy D-Rose. The bulls already have bangers on the front line, now they need some shooting and finesse to compliment it. Matt Bonner 2.0?
